Candidates violating election code of conduct in Gujranwala
From Our Correspondent
GUJRANWALA: Candidates are allegedly violating the election code of conduct during their campaign for the local government elections in the district.
The candidates are violating the code of conduct by using loudspeakers, holding rallies, blocking streets and roads, displaying huge banners and hoardings throughout the city. The candidates are also spending huge money on electioneering. The district returning officer has already directed the authorities concerned to ensure the implementation of code of conduct and for removal of oversize banners and hoardings but no action is being taken in this regard.
The people have demanded the district administration take action in this regard and direct the candidates to strictly follow the code of conduct.
